Patent number: 9007760Abstract: A hinge assembly having a hollow clutch is arranged to pivotally couple a portable computer base portion to a portable computer lid portion. The hinge assembly includes at least a hollow cylindrical portion that includes an annular outer region and a central bore region, the central bore region suitably arranged to provide support for electrical conductors between the base and lid portions. The hinge assembly also includes a plurality of fastening components that couple the hollow clutch to the base portion and the lid portion of the portable computer, with at least one of the fastening regions being integrally formed with the hollow cylindrical portion such that space, size and part count are minimized. The integrally formed fastening region(s) can be flat with holes dispersed therethrough for screws, bolts or the like. The central bore can also support a heat transfer element and can also serve as a lubricant reservoir.Type: GrantFiled: June 4, 2013Date of Patent: April 14, 2015Inventors: Brett William Degner, John M. Publication number: 20150022970Abstract: A ratchet module disposed in an electronic apparatus realizes one-way push-push function for a functional module. The ratchet module includes a first member and a second member meshed with each other with axially extending ratchet such that the second member may be pushed to rotate in one direction with respect to the first member. A torque spring disposed between the two members is twisted to accumulate a restoring force as the second member is moved by the functional module sliding in a housing and rotated with respect to the first member. The second member is served to maintain the position of the functional module. A button is further used in the ratchet module to push the second member to disengage from the first member, allowing the twisted torque spring to rotate the second member automatically in a reverse direction that pushes the functional module to slide reversely in the housing.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 17, 2013Publication date: January 22, 2015Applicant: Wistron CorporationInventor: Syuan-He Shih
